If you thought Jay and Silent Bob showing up in Call of Duty was wild, it looks like Seth Rogen might be the next operator joining the CoD universe.


During a teaser for Call of Duty’s highly anticipated Blaze Town event — a 4/20 takeover of the iconic Nuketown map — players spotted a not-so-subtle Easter egg: a character named " CanadianSmokeMonster " joins a lobby, followed by Seth Rogen’s unmistakable laugh.


The hint dropped during a video featuring Jason Mewes and Kevin Smith (Jay and Silent Bob), who already joined the Call of Duty roster earlier this month. With both Mewes and Smith exchanging stunned looks after hearing the laugh, it’s clear Activision is playing into the hype that Rogen could be next.


Fun fact: Rogen is a well-known gamer and cannabis enthusiast, making him a perfect fit for the Blaze of Glory themed event.


What's Coming in CoD’s Blaze of Glory Event?


The Blaze of Glory update promises major content additions for Call of Duty: Warzone and Modern Warfare III players:


Blaze Town Map: A weed-themed Nuketown re-skin


New Operator Bundles: Featuring Jay, Silent Bob, and possibly Seth Rogen


New Weapon: Early leaks suggest a unique SMG built for aggressive gameplay


Ranked Play for Warzone: A competitive ranked mode for battle royale fans


New Multiplayer Maps: Expanding the Season 3 rotation



The midseason Reloaded update was delayed slightly due to Season 3's slow start, but it is expected to launch around May 1st , 2025.
